#EEAB5C Hex color

#EEAB5C

The hexadecimal color code #EEAB5C corresponds to the code RGB( 238, 171, 92 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,93 level), green (at 0,67 level) and blue (at 0,36 level). Its brightness is 64% and its saturation is 81%. It is composed of red at 47%, green at 34% and blue at 18%.
